Serum and urine levels of tamoxifen and its metabolites in patients with advanced breast cancer after a loading dose and at steady-state levels.

作者信息

de Vos D, Slee P H, Briggs R J, Stevenson D

机构信息

Medical Department Pharmachemie BV, Haarlem, The Netherlands.

出版信息

Cancer Chemother Pharmacol. 1998;42(6):512-4. doi: 10.1007/s002800050854.

Abstract

PURPOSE

To compare serum and urine levels of tamoxifen and metabolites after a loading dose and at the steady state.

METHODS

A loading dose of 160 mg of tamoxifen was given to 14 patients with advanced breast cancer. Thereafter a regular daily dose of 30 mg of tamoxifen was given. Serum and urine levels of tamoxifen and metabolites were measured by high-performance liquid chromatography and compared with levels determined in 31 patients with advanced breast cancer at the steady state at a daily dose of 30 mg of tamoxifen.

RESULTS

Serum and urine levels (24-h values) of tamoxifen and metabolites were lower (P < 0.05) after a loading dose than at the steady state. The difference was most pronounced for the metabolites, whereas the tamoxifen loading-dose level was near the steady state.

CONCLUSION

Tamoxifen steady state can be reached in 1-2 days by the administration of a loading dose of 160 mg of tamoxifen for 2 days. Tamoxifen metabolite steady-state levels are reached regularly after 4 or more weeks during application of a loading dose. Very little tamoxifen or metabolites are excreted into the urine.

摘要

目的

比较负荷剂量及稳态时他莫昔芬及其代谢产物的血清和尿液水平。

方法

对14例晚期乳腺癌患者给予160mg他莫昔芬的负荷剂量。此后,每日给予常规剂量30mg他莫昔芬。采用高效液相色谱法测定他莫昔芬及其代谢产物的血清和尿液水平,并与31例每日剂量30mg他莫昔芬达到稳态的晚期乳腺癌患者所测定的水平进行比较。

结果

负荷剂量后他莫昔芬及其代谢产物的血清和尿液水平(24小时值)低于稳态时(P<0.05)。代谢产物的差异最为明显,而他莫昔芬负荷剂量水平接近稳态。

结论

给予2天160mg他莫昔芬的负荷剂量可在1-2天内达到他莫昔芬稳态。在应用负荷剂量4周或更长时间后,他莫昔芬代谢产物可定期达到稳态水平。极少有他莫昔芬或其代谢产物排泄到尿液中。
